Cecil Teen Convicted of Killing Mother in India
Media reports indicate Joncarlo Patton was sentenced to three years in a 'special home.'

A teenage boy from Cecil has been sentenced to three years in an Indian home for juvenile offenders after it convicted him of killing his mother.
The Press Trust of India reported that Joncarlo Patton was convicted and remanded to a "special home" for juveniles after more than six months of court proceedings.
"Pronouncing the verdict on Monday, the Juvenile Justice Board convicted the teenager for murdering his mother Cynthia Iannarelli in August last year in a desert resort, some 65-km from Jodhpur," the web site reported on Tuesday.

The Justice Board also convicted him of destroying evidence, the report indicates.
Media reports indicate the teenager maintained his innocence, and wrote a letter to the board indicating he believed that he was "wrongly implicated" in the case.
